本文目录导读:
在信息化时代,数据仓库和数据库是两种至关重要的技术,它们在数据管理、分析、挖掘等方面发挥着重要作用,数据仓库和数据库之间有何紧密关系?它们又是如何协同作用的呢?本文将为您揭晓答案。
数据仓库与数据库的定义
1、数据库
数据库(Database)是按照数据结构来组织、存储和管理数据的仓库,它能够有效地存储、检索和管理大量的数据,为各种应用提供数据支持,数据库系统通常由数据库、数据库管理系统(DBMS)、应用程序和用户组成。
2、数据仓库
图片来源于网络,如有侵权联系删除
数据仓库(Data Warehouse)是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持管理决策,数据仓库将来自多个数据源的数据进行整合、清洗、转换,形成一致性的数据视图,为用户提供全面、深入的数据分析。
数据仓库与数据库的关系
1、数据仓库是数据库的扩展
数据仓库在本质上是一种数据库,但它并非普通数据库,数据仓库是对传统数据库的扩展,它关注数据的整合、分析和管理,以满足企业决策需求。
2、数据仓库与数据库的关联
(1)数据来源:数据仓库的数据来源于多个数据库,包括企业内部数据库、外部数据库等,这些数据经过整合、清洗、转换后,形成数据仓库中的数据。
(2)数据结构:数据仓库采用面向主题的数据模型,与传统数据库的表格模型有所不同,这种模型有利于数据的整合和分析。
图片来源于网络,如有侵权联系删除
(3)数据一致性:数据仓库中的数据经过清洗、转换,确保数据的一致性,而传统数据库中的数据可能存在冗余、错误等问题。
(4)数据更新:数据仓库中的数据相对稳定,更新频率较低,而传统数据库中的数据需要实时更新。
数据仓库与数据库的协同作用
1、数据仓库为数据库提供决策支持
数据仓库通过整合、分析数据库中的数据,为企业提供决策支持,这有助于企业优化业务流程、提高运营效率、降低成本。
2、数据库为数据仓库提供数据来源
数据库作为数据仓库的数据来源,为数据仓库提供丰富的数据资源,数据库的稳定运行和数据质量直接影响到数据仓库的性能。
图片来源于网络,如有侵权联系删除
3、数据仓库与数据库相互促进
(1)数据仓库的发展推动了数据库技术的进步,如大数据、云计算等技术。
(2)数据库技术的进步为数据仓库提供了更强大的数据处理能力,如实时数据仓库、分布式数据库等。
数据仓库与数据库是两种紧密相关的技术,它们在数据管理、分析、挖掘等方面发挥着重要作用,共同推动企业信息化发展,了解两者之间的关系和协同作用,有助于企业更好地利用数据,实现业务目标。
标签: #数据仓库和数据库是相关的两种技术
评论列表